Geothermal to Scale

Geothermal to Scale: Corporate PPAs + Drilling Gains; Policy Shifts Make Clean, Firm Power Bankable - Quarter 3 2025

Case for tracking:

Earlier, geothermal was gaining credibility through U.S. funding and EGS pilots, though progress was slowed by long permitting cycles and uncertain early economics. Lithium co-production from geothermal brines was also emerging as a potential revenue stream at pilot scale. By Q3 2025, momentum has accelerated: Germany moved to classify geothermal as a project of “overriding public interest,” and bipartisan U.S. proposals aim to cut permitting delays. Corporate demand is rising, with Google and Meta signing PPAs to power AI-driven data centres.

On the tech side, drilling innovations like millimetre-wave and closed-loop systems are being touted as cost-breakers, while new markets are stepping in India’s first well in Dirang signals geographic diversification. Geothermal is now shifting from viability testing to being positioned as scalable, bankable, and central to clean firm power.
